Hey there, it's Cheniece.

This episode is a quieter one — not the kind with tidy lessons at the end, just the truth of a season I went silent on you about. I'm talking about the move, the house, the woman my mother's upbringing made me… and the sticky kind of depressive episode I don't usually say out loud, let alone record.

If you've ever gone quiet on the people who care about you because you didn't know how to explain where you actually were, if you've ever had to learn the difference between the price of a thing and the value of it the hard way, or if writing — or some other quiet practice — has ever been the thing that pulled you back to yourself… this one's for you.

Episode Overview:

This episode picks up where the silence left off. I talk about our move into a new home, what "home" has actually meant across most of my marriage, the Mississippi upbringing that shaped how I hold money and value, and a depressive episode I've lived through more than once — plus the unglamorous, ongoing practice that's helped pull me out of it every time. This is me handing you the truth instead of an apology.
